本文关键词:ftp下的内部网站建设
别整那些虚头巴脑的云服务器了,很多老板觉得搞个内部网非得搞什么高大上的架构,其实对于咱们这种小团队或者传统企业,ftp下的内部网站建设才是真香定律。今天我就把压箱底的经验掏出来,不玩概念,直接说怎么用最少的钱、最稳的方式,把公司内部那个能传文件、能看公告的网站搭起来。
首先得纠正一个误区,很多人一听FTP就觉得是上个世纪的东西,慢、不安全。那是你没用对地方。如果你只是要在局域网内或者通过专线连接的公司内部用,FTP简直是最简单粗暴且稳定的方案。不需要复杂的数据库配置,不需要担心高并发崩溃,传个文件刷新一下页面就出来了。这对于那些不懂代码、只想要个展示窗口的行政或人事部门来说,简直是福音。
咱们第一步,先搞定服务器环境。别去买那些花里胡哨的SaaS平台,去阿里云或者腾讯云买台最便宜的轻量应用服务器,或者如果你公司有闲置的电脑,装个Windows Server也行。重点是要装好IIS(Internet Information Services),这是Windows系统自带的,不用额外花钱。装好IIS后,打开“服务”管理器,确保World Wide Web Publishing Service是启动状态。这一步如果搞不定,后面的都别谈了,建议找个懂电脑的小年轻帮忙,或者去B站搜“Win10开启IIS”,视频里看得懂。
第二步,配置FTP站点。在IIS管理器里,右键网站->添加FTP站点。站点名称随便起,比如“内网资料库”。物理路径选你存放网页文件的文件夹,记得权限给足,读写都要开。接着设置绑定信息,IP地址填服务器的内网IP,端口默认21就行。SSL选择“无SSL”,因为内网传输没必要搞那么复杂,省得证书麻烦。用户许可选“所有用户”,这样方便管理。
第三步,设置用户权限。这是最关键的一步,也是很多人踩坑的地方。在FTP防火墙支持里,数据通道端口范围填一个大的区间,比如50000-51000,然后在Windows防火墙里放行这个端口范围,不然外网连不进来。创建具体的用户账号,比如“admin”和“guest”,给admin完全控制权限,给guest只读权限。这样员工只能看不能改,老板能改不能看,权责分明。
第四步,上传文件测试。用FileZilla或者浏览器访问ftp://服务器IP。如果能登录成功,说明网络通了。把你做好的HTML文件拖进去,覆盖掉默认的index.html。这时候在浏览器输入http://服务器IP,应该就能看到你的网站了。如果打不开,检查防火墙是不是把80端口拦了,或者IIS的服务没重启。
这里有个小坑,很多新手以为FTP就是传文件,其实FTP下的内部网站建设核心在于权限管理和文件结构。别把所有文件都扔根目录,建个images、css、js文件夹分类放,不然以后维护起来你会想哭。另外,记得定期备份,虽然FTP简单,但硬盘坏了也是白搭。
最后说句心里话,别被那些“数字化转型”的大词吓住。对于大多数中小企业,稳定、简单、成本低才是硬道理。ftp下的内部网站建设虽然听起来土,但它能解决90%的内部信息同步问题。不用天天担心被黑客攻击,不用花大价钱请运维,自己就能搞定。
当然,要是你们公司以后规模大了,员工超过500人,或者需要实时协作,那再考虑上WordPress或者自建系统。但现在,先把这个FTP站点搭起来,让员工能方便地下载最新版的员工手册,能查看最新的通知,这就够了。别追求完美,先追求能用。
记住,技术是为业务服务的,不是用来炫技的。把ftp下的内部网站建设做好了,省下的钱请团队喝奶茶不香吗?要是遇到什么具体报错,别慌,百度搜一下错误代码,99%的问题别人都遇到过。实在不行,回来找我,虽然我不一定回,但你可以试试。加油,打工人!